Output 39c9fb12bb07991fe3079af2d348cc54152e1baecf1bc62ffb27cac6078c4c44:1

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b97259250b0b4b4c2d61fa87616f5714364991e0 OP_EQUAL
address
3JbZv5wt56cHSDDBrbJGdK5CFa8KUZLj4F
transaction
39c9fb12bb07991fe3079af2d348cc54152e1baecf1bc62ffb27cac6078c4c44
confirmations
129331
spent
true